A strange mortician tells four horrific tales to three drug dealers that he traps in their local funeral parlor.

"SO fun, a great slice of campy 90's black-directed, black-produced horror. the american flag is purposefully used in two shorts to highlight the hypocrisy of the american judicial and administrative systems with regards to black men--most memorably clutched by a 'former' KKK member like a security blanket trying to ward off his ancestral and personal karma.
the mural short feels like a homage to the original Candyman film, and that one is the most emotionally devastating wrt police brutality.
but my favorite is the monster short, with the sympathetic magic and the teacher who makes a difference by paying attention and acting on his gut instincts (not really sure why the mother was flirting with another man so hard so close to her husband coming home, but ok). the classroom design brought me right back to my elementary school years (tho we didn't have the fancy dress code)."
